When calculating the excise tax on failure to transmit deferrals timely, if I understand it correctly, the excise tax is 15% for each taxable year that the correction is not made.

I'm not sure when the correction is deemed to be made. Is the correction made when the deferrals are deposited? The interest on late deferrals is deposited? The excise tax on the prohibited transaction is paid?
